The Bharatiya Janata Party-led government is fighting over the Nehru Memorial Museum and Library in New Delhi. There was a controversy over the appointment of Mahesh Rangarajan as the director of the NMML. Dr. Rangarajan, a respected scholar and academic, was eventually forced to tender his resignation. The Congress party thinks of the Memorial as its fiefdom and thought nothing of rushing through the appointment process just before the country went into election mode.
Despite assurances from Prime Minister Narendra Modi to revere the memory of Nehru, it is now quite apparent that members of his Cabinet, who draw their strength and inspiration from the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h, are not willing to let the Museum be. Murmurs about changing the basic structure of the Museum to make it “more contemporary” have slowly gained ground. There is a proposal to turn the NMML into a memorial for governance.
